En los albores del siglo octavo, un bebé es abandonado a la puerta de un pequeño monasterio dúplice, donde se cría felizmente entre la comunidad religiosa hasta que conoce a Lea, una joven judía. Desde aquel encuentro, la tranquila existencia del joven Juan se verá arrastrada por nuevos senderos que le abrirán los ojos, más allá del discurrir de su placentera existencia. Juan conocerá a diversos personajes que irán marcando su personalidad. Entre ellos Elipando, obispo de Toledo, y su enemigo en asuntos teológicos, el Beato de Liébana. También trabará estrecha amistad con el joven Alfonso, que llegará a ser rey de Asturias, y hasta asistirá a la proclamación de Carlomagno como emperador del Sacro Imperio Germánico. Una apasionante vida repleta de aventuras y desventuras, con el sempiterno amor a Lea como telón de fondo, en una época convulsa en la que se tejían los finos hilos de una nueva Europa.
